Mechanical Designer

The Mechanical Designer works under the direction of the Project Manager and also utilizes independent judgment to perform the day-to-day project duties of designing, developing and releasing deliverables. This includes detail & assembly drawings and related bills-of material used in the fabrication of equipment for petrochemical, power generation and gas compression (largely assemblies for fluid & gas handling). Primary responsibility involves generating design plans utilizing Autodesk Inventor and AutoCAD software. This position requires a high level of attention to detail. You will be trained in API equipment design standards.
